Specific characteristics in the Chemical Industry: safety inside ATEX-classified zones.

Here, hazardous substances, explosion-protected areas, and long transport routes converge.

In tank farms, filling stations, and ATEX-classified production areas, blind intersections and mixed traffic between forklifts, tankers, and pedestrians turn routine encounters into high-consequence risks. Linde Safety Guard addresses this very point: as a technical, explosion-protected assistance system.

Problems in the Chemical Industry:

  • ATEX zones restrict standard equipment
    Only certified components may operate in classified zones, which limits which safety technology plants can even deploy.

  • Hazardous substances raise the stakes of every collision
    A forklift collision near a tank farm or filling station can mean a leak or ignition source, not just property damage.

  • Long transport routes cross mixed traffic
    Tankers, forklifts, and pedestrians share narrow site roads between production, storage, and loading.

  • Protective equipment limits perception
    Respirators, chemical suits, and hearing protection reduce peripheral vision and the ability to hear an approaching vehicle.

  • Infrastructure bottlenecks concentrate risk
    Pipe bridges, containment areas, and fixed installations narrow site layouts at exactly the points where traffic has to cross.

  • Incidents carry regulatory and environmental consequences
    A collision in a hazardous area can trigger containment breaches, reporting obligations, and production shutdowns, not just downtime.

How Linde Safety Guard supports:

  • Built for explosion-protected areas
    both in ATEX zones 1 and 2.

  • Early warning before critical approaches
    Vehicles and pedestrians are warned before proximity becomes a hazard, not after.

  • Configurable speed zones for hazardous areas
    Two independently defined speed zones, as implemented at BASF Düsseldorf, slow traffic exactly where explosion risk is highest.

  • Assistance where PPE limits the senses
    A technical warning compensates for reduced visibility and hearing under respirators and protective suits.

  • Protects people, product, and plant availability
    Fewer near-misses mean less risk of containment breaches, downtime, and regulatory incidents.

"Dangerous areas in one of our explosion-proof areas could be effectively defused with the new explosion-proof version of the Linde Safety Guard. Pedestrians are warned in good time by flashing lights at dangerous areas in forklift traffic. The speed of the forklift is reduced fully automatically and precisely. When pedestrians leave the danger area, the vehicle automatically increases its speed again. We are all very satisfied with the Linde Safety Guard."

 

Ralf Froitzheim, Asset Management, BASF Personal Care and Nutrition GmbH, Düsseldorf, Germany
